SQL Server Management Studio 2016 下载及使用指南
SQL Server Management Studio (SSMS) 是微软为 SQL Server 数据库管理提供的一款强大工具。它为数据库开发者和管理员提供了一系列丰富的功能,包括查询编辑器、图形用户界面、数据抓取工具等。本文将为您详细介绍如何下载 SQL Server Management Studio 2016,并提供一些实用的代码示例,帮助您更好地掌握这款软件。
一、下载 SQL Server Management Studio 2016
首先,我们需要了解如何下载 SSMS。以下是步骤:
- 访问微软官网或其它可信赖的软件下载网站。
- 搜索 "SQL Server Management Studio 2016"。
- 找到完整的安装包,并点击下载。
重要提醒
在下载软件时,确保选择官方渠道,避免潜在的安全问题。
二、安装步骤
下载完成后,您可以按照以下步骤进行安装:
- 双击安装包,运行安装程序。
- 按照提示进行设置,包括选择安装路径和组件选择。
- 安装完成后,启动 SQL Server Management Studio。
三、基本界面和功能
打开 SSMS 后,您会看到主界面,上方是工具栏,左侧是对象资源管理器,右侧是查询编辑器。对象资源管理器可以让您浏览数据库中的表、视图、存储过程等对象。
界面示意图
journey
title SQL Server Management Studio 使用旅程
section 打开 SSMS
启动程序: 5: 用户
登录数据库: 4: 用户
section 数据库管理
创建新数据库: 5: 用户
浏览并查询数据: 4: 用户
section 数据分析
运行 SQL 查询: 5: 用户
查看查询结果: 4: 用户
四、基本 SQL 查询示例
在 SSMS 中,您可以使用 T-SQL(Transact-SQL)编写查询。以下是一些常用的 SQL 示例:
1. 创建新数据库
CREATE DATABASE SampleDB;
GO
2. 创建表
USE SampleDB;
GO
CREATE TABLE Employees (
EmployeeID INT PRIMARY KEY IDENTITY,
FirstName NVARCHAR(50),
LastName NVARCHAR(50),
BirthDate DATE,
HireDate DATE
);
GO
3. 插入数据
INSERT INTO Employees (FirstName, LastName, BirthDate, HireDate)
VALUES ('John', 'Doe', '1980-01-01', '2020-01-01'),
('Jane', 'Smith', '1990-02-02', '2021-02-02');
GO
4. 查询数据
SELECT * FROM Employees;
GO
五、甘特图示例 - 数据库项目管理
在进行数据库项目时,使用甘特图可以帮助我们更好地管理进度。以下是一个简单的甘特图示例,描述了创建和维护数据库的流程。
gantt
title 数据库项目进度
dateFormat YYYY-MM-DD
section 前期准备
调研需求 :a1, 2023-10-01, 10d
设计数据库结构 :after a1 , 10d
section 实施阶段
创建数据库 :a2, after a1 , 5d
插入测试数据 :after a2 , 5d
section 测试阶段
功能测试 :a3, after a2 , 5d
性能测试 :after a3 , 5d
六、监控和优化数据库
SSMS 提供了一些内置工具来监控和优化数据库性能。通过“活动监视器”,您可以查看当前正在运行的查询及其资源消耗。优化你的 SQL 查询,能够使得数据库能够更快速的响应请求。
示例:查看当前活动会话
SELECT * FROM sys.dm_exec_sessions;
GO
七、结尾
SQL Server Management Studio 2016 是一个功能强大的数据库管理工具,非常适合个人和团队使用。通过本文,您应该对如何下载、安装以及基本使用 SSMS 有了一个全面的了解,并掌握了一些基础的 SQL 查询和数据库管理知识。
如果您正在或计划使用 SQL Server 进行开发或管理工作,建议深入学习 SSMS 的高级功能,定期练习 SQL,让数据库操作变得更加高效,提升工作效率。希望您在使用 SSMS 的过程中能够收获满满!如果您在使用过程中遇到问题,可以参考微软的官方文档或加入相关的开发者社区进行交流。
感谢您的阅读,希望这篇文章能够帮助到您!
















